Sýn To Close TV News Production Effective Tonight, August 31
1+ week, 5+ day ago (335+ words) In a press release from Sýn to the Icelandic Stock Exchange, the largest private media company in the country announced it was ceasing its TV news effective tonight, August 31, 2026. “A diverse group of outstanding reporters, production staff and other staff…...

Tímatál – Art Exhibition
3+ week, 4+ day ago (109+ words) Skálda Bookstore, Vesturgata 10a, 101, Reykjavík In Tímatál, Jón Ingiberg works with imagery, headlines and text from Icelandic magazines and newspapers from the mid-20th century, placing them in a new context. By adding coffee and ink, new stories emerge from old imagery,…...
